Pre-Sale and Post-Sale Teams Must Share Common Qualification Frameworks
“There's no sales framework that's Pre and post sale. If you decide qualification is med pick, everyone speaks the language of method, whatever you pick, it's common.”

Customers Are Always Willing to Pay for Priority Support
“Customers always are willing to pay to be front of line for support. So that always, no one wants, if someone says VIP, will you pay for the FASF? Fast? Of course you'll pay for the VIP FASF. Fast. That's always how it works.”
